#430d65 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#430d65 is composed of 26.3% red, 5.1% green and 39.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 33.7% cyan, 87.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 60.4% black. It has a hue angle of 276.8 degrees, a saturation of 77.2% and a lightness of 22.4%. #430d65 color hex could be obtained by blending #861aca with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#330066.

Shades and Tints of #430d65

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#09020e is the darkest color, while #fdfcff is the lightest one.

Tones of #430d65

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#393939 is the less saturated color, while #45046e is the most saturated one.
